新聞中心

E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 系統(tǒng)總線的組成及其特點(diǎn)

系統(tǒng)總線的組成及其特點(diǎn)

作者: 時(shí)間:2016-12-14 來(lái)源:網(wǎng)絡(luò) 收藏
現(xiàn)場(chǎng)總線控制系統(tǒng)概念、組成、特點(diǎn)
FCS
  現(xiàn)場(chǎng)總線控制是工業(yè)設(shè)備自動(dòng)化控制的一種計(jì)算機(jī)局域網(wǎng)絡(luò)。它是依靠具有檢測(cè)、控制、通信
能力的微處理芯片,數(shù)字化儀表(設(shè)備)在現(xiàn)場(chǎng)實(shí)現(xiàn)徹底分散控制,并以這些現(xiàn)場(chǎng)分散的測(cè)量,控
制設(shè)備單個(gè)點(diǎn)作為網(wǎng)絡(luò)節(jié)點(diǎn),將這些點(diǎn)以總線形式連接起來(lái),形成一個(gè)現(xiàn)場(chǎng)總線控制系統(tǒng)。它是屬
于最底層的網(wǎng)絡(luò)系統(tǒng),是網(wǎng)絡(luò)集成式全分布控制系統(tǒng),它將原來(lái)集散型的DCS系統(tǒng)現(xiàn)場(chǎng)控制機(jī)的功能
,全部分散在各個(gè)網(wǎng)絡(luò)節(jié)點(diǎn)處。為此,可以將原來(lái)封閉、專(zhuān)用的系統(tǒng)變成開(kāi)放、標(biāo)準(zhǔn)的系統(tǒng)。使得
不同制造商的產(chǎn)品可以互連,是DCS系統(tǒng)的更新?lián)Q代,大大簡(jiǎn)化系統(tǒng)結(jié)構(gòu),降低成本,更好滿足了實(shí)
事性要求,提高了系統(tǒng)運(yùn)行的可靠性。不同通信協(xié)議的現(xiàn)場(chǎng)總線控制系統(tǒng)一般通過(guò)工業(yè)PC機(jī)內(nèi)總線
插槽的PC接口板與現(xiàn)場(chǎng)總線網(wǎng)段連接。
  現(xiàn)場(chǎng)總線控制系統(tǒng)由測(cè)量系統(tǒng)、控制系統(tǒng)、管理系統(tǒng)三個(gè)部分組成,而通信部分的硬、軟件是
它最有特色的部分。
  1、現(xiàn)場(chǎng)總線控制系統(tǒng):
  它的軟件是系統(tǒng)的重要組成部分,控制系統(tǒng)的軟件有組態(tài)軟件、維護(hù)軟件、仿真軟件、設(shè)備軟
件和監(jiān)控軟件等。首先選擇開(kāi)發(fā)組態(tài)軟件、控制操作人機(jī)接口軟件MMI。通過(guò)組態(tài)軟件,完成功能塊
之間的連接,選定功能塊參數(shù),進(jìn)行網(wǎng)絡(luò)組態(tài)。在網(wǎng)絡(luò)運(yùn)行過(guò)程中對(duì)系統(tǒng)實(shí)時(shí)采集數(shù)據(jù)、進(jìn)行數(shù)據(jù)
處理、計(jì)算。優(yōu)化控制及邏輯控制報(bào)警、監(jiān)視、顯示、報(bào)表等。
  2、現(xiàn)場(chǎng)總線的測(cè)量系統(tǒng):
  其特點(diǎn)為多變量高性能的測(cè)量,使測(cè)量?jī)x表具有計(jì)算能力等更多功能,由于采用數(shù)字信號(hào),具
有高分辨率,準(zhǔn)確性高、抗干擾、抗畸變能力強(qiáng),同時(shí)還具有儀表設(shè)備的狀態(tài)信息,可以對(duì)處理過(guò)
程進(jìn)行調(diào)整。
  3、設(shè)備管理系統(tǒng):
  可以提供設(shè)備自身及過(guò)程的診斷信息、管理信息、設(shè)備運(yùn)行狀態(tài)信息(包括智能儀表)、廠商
提供的設(shè)備制造信息。例如Fisher-Rosemoune公司,推出AMS管理系統(tǒng),它安裝在主機(jī)算機(jī)內(nèi),由它
完成管理功能,可以構(gòu)成一個(gè)現(xiàn)場(chǎng)設(shè)備的綜合管理系統(tǒng)信息庫(kù),在此基礎(chǔ)上實(shí)現(xiàn)設(shè)備的可靠性分析
以及預(yù)測(cè)性維護(hù)。將被動(dòng)的管理模式改變?yōu)榭深A(yù)測(cè)性的管理維護(hù)模式AMS軟件是以現(xiàn)場(chǎng)服務(wù)器為平臺(tái)
的T型結(jié)構(gòu),在現(xiàn)場(chǎng)服務(wù)器上支撐模塊化,功能豐富的應(yīng)用軟件為用戶提供一個(gè)圖形化界面。
  4、總線系統(tǒng)計(jì)算機(jī)服務(wù)模式:
  以客戶機(jī)/服務(wù)器模式是目前較為流行的網(wǎng)絡(luò)計(jì)算機(jī)服務(wù)模式。服務(wù)器表示數(shù)據(jù)源(提供者
),應(yīng)用客戶機(jī)則表示數(shù)據(jù)使用者,它從數(shù)據(jù)源獲取數(shù)據(jù),并進(jìn)一步進(jìn)行處理??头繖C(jī)運(yùn)行在
PC機(jī)或工作站上。服務(wù)器運(yùn)行在小型機(jī)或大型機(jī)上,它使用雙方的智能、資源、數(shù)據(jù)來(lái)完成任務(wù)
。
  5、數(shù)據(jù)庫(kù):
  它能有組織的、動(dòng)態(tài)的存儲(chǔ)大量有關(guān)數(shù)據(jù)與應(yīng)用程序,實(shí)現(xiàn)數(shù)據(jù)的充分共享、交叉訪問(wèn),具有
高度獨(dú)立性。工業(yè)設(shè)備在運(yùn)行過(guò)程中參數(shù)連續(xù)變化,數(shù)據(jù)量大,操作與控制的實(shí)時(shí)性要求很高。因
此就形成了一個(gè)可以互訪操作的分布關(guān)系及實(shí)時(shí)性的數(shù)據(jù)庫(kù)系統(tǒng),市面上成熟的供選用的如關(guān)系數(shù)
據(jù)庫(kù)中的Orad,sybas,Informix,SQL Server;實(shí)時(shí)數(shù)據(jù)庫(kù)中的Infoplus,PI,ONSPEC等。
  6、網(wǎng)絡(luò)系統(tǒng)的硬件與軟件:
  網(wǎng)絡(luò)系統(tǒng)硬件有:系統(tǒng)管理主機(jī)、服務(wù)器、網(wǎng)關(guān)、協(xié)議變換器、集線器,用戶計(jì)算機(jī)等及底層
智能化儀表。網(wǎng)絡(luò)系統(tǒng)軟件有網(wǎng)絡(luò)操作軟件如:NetWarc,LAN Mangger,Vines,服務(wù)器操作軟件如
Lenix,os/2,Window NT。應(yīng)用軟件數(shù)據(jù)庫(kù)、通信協(xié)議、網(wǎng)絡(luò)管理協(xié)議等。
  1、在功能上管理集中,控制分散,在結(jié)構(gòu)上橫向分散、縱向分級(jí)。
  2、要有快速實(shí)時(shí)響應(yīng)能力,對(duì)于工業(yè)設(shè)備的局域網(wǎng)絡(luò),它主要的通信量是過(guò)程信息及操作管理
信息,信息量不大,傳輸速率不高在1MPS以下,信息傳輸任務(wù)相對(duì)比較簡(jiǎn)單但其實(shí)時(shí)響應(yīng)時(shí)間要求
較高為0.01-0.5S。所謂實(shí)時(shí)性是在網(wǎng)絡(luò)通信過(guò)程中能在線實(shí)時(shí)采集過(guò)程的參數(shù),實(shí)時(shí)對(duì)系統(tǒng)信息進(jìn)
行加工處理,并迅速反饋給系統(tǒng)完成過(guò)程控制,滿足過(guò)程控制對(duì)時(shí)間限制的要求。除了控制管理計(jì)
算機(jī)系統(tǒng)的外部設(shè)備外,還要控制管理控制系為統(tǒng)的設(shè)備,并具有處理隨機(jī)事件能力。實(shí)際操作系
統(tǒng)應(yīng)保證在異常情況下及時(shí)處置,保證完成任務(wù),或完成最重要的任務(wù),要求能及時(shí)發(fā)現(xiàn)糾正隨機(jī)
性錯(cuò)誤,至少保證不使錯(cuò)誤影響擴(kuò)大,應(yīng)具有抵制錯(cuò)誤操作和錯(cuò)誤輸入信息的能力。實(shí)現(xiàn)現(xiàn)場(chǎng)總線
控制系統(tǒng)實(shí)時(shí)性的主要措施為:
 ?。?)OSI協(xié)議中7層都是提供高度的功能性服務(wù),為此降低了通信流量和增大傳輸時(shí)間,因而影
響實(shí)時(shí)響應(yīng)能力。因此將OSI七層通信協(xié)議,采取不同程度的簡(jiǎn)化,減少由于層間轉(zhuǎn)換的復(fù)雜性,而
影響實(shí)時(shí)響應(yīng)能力?,F(xiàn)場(chǎng)總線控制系統(tǒng)的通信協(xié)議一般為物理層、鏈路層、應(yīng)用層,再增加一個(gè)用
戶作為網(wǎng)絡(luò)節(jié)點(diǎn),互連成底層總線網(wǎng)。如PRUFIBUS總層的四層結(jié)構(gòu)。
 ?。?))把基本控制功能下放到現(xiàn)場(chǎng)具有智能的芯片或功能塊中,使控制功能徹底分散,直接面
對(duì)對(duì)象,接口直觀簡(jiǎn)、結(jié)。把同時(shí)具有控制、測(cè)量與通信功能的功能塊,與功能塊應(yīng)用進(jìn)程,作為
網(wǎng)絡(luò)節(jié)點(diǎn),互連成底層總線網(wǎng)。如PRUFIBUS總線系統(tǒng),按照主站、從站分,把底層的通信及控制集
中在從站來(lái)完成。各公司廠商提供較齊全的各類(lèi)主站與從站列芯片,實(shí)現(xiàn)起來(lái)簡(jiǎn)單又便宜。有如
LONWORKS雖然通信協(xié)議與OSI相同為七層,但全部固化在一個(gè)神經(jīng)芯元片中,不需要經(jīng)網(wǎng)絡(luò)傳輸,同
樣可加快實(shí)時(shí)響應(yīng)能力,同時(shí)應(yīng)用程序定義一個(gè)特殊對(duì)象網(wǎng)絡(luò)變量存在于神經(jīng)元芯片ROM中
,它是在節(jié)點(diǎn)代碼編譯時(shí)確定,將不同節(jié)點(diǎn)。同類(lèi)型的網(wǎng)絡(luò)變量連接起來(lái)進(jìn)行自控,大大簡(jiǎn)化了開(kāi)
發(fā)和安裝分布系統(tǒng)過(guò)程。
 ?。?)介質(zhì)訪問(wèn)協(xié)議:一般采用令牌傳遞總線訪問(wèn)方式(TOKEN BUS)既可達(dá)到通信快速的目的
,又可以有較高的性?xún)r(jià)比,對(duì)于多路訪問(wèn)沖突檢測(cè)(CSMA/CD)方法,雖然通信管理上較為簡(jiǎn)單,但
并不能完全避免碰撞現(xiàn)象,實(shí)現(xiàn)沖突檢測(cè)比較復(fù)雜,此外在線路中常態(tài)干擾與差錯(cuò)往往和碰撞難以
區(qū)別,因此對(duì)現(xiàn)場(chǎng)總線控制系統(tǒng)實(shí)時(shí)性要求較高的場(chǎng)合,并不十分適合。所以大部分總線控制系統(tǒng)
均為令牌傳遞訪問(wèn)。只有LONWORKS采用改進(jìn)型的,即帶預(yù)測(cè)P的CSMA訪問(wèn)方式。當(dāng)一個(gè)節(jié)點(diǎn)需要發(fā)送
信息時(shí),先帶預(yù)測(cè)P測(cè)一下網(wǎng)絡(luò)是否空閑,有空閑則發(fā)送,沒(méi)有空閑則暫時(shí)不發(fā),這樣就避免了碰
撞減少了網(wǎng)絡(luò)碰撞率,提高了重載時(shí)的效率。并采用了緊急優(yōu)先機(jī)制,以提高它的實(shí)時(shí)性與可靠性
。
 ?。?)通信方式:一般分調(diào)度通信和非調(diào)度通信多數(shù)為調(diào)度通信,用于設(shè)備間周期性傳輸,控制
的數(shù)據(jù)預(yù)先設(shè)定。非調(diào)度通信用于參數(shù)設(shè)置、設(shè)備診斷報(bào)警處理。從其功能上分,有主站與從站區(qū)
分。從站僅對(duì)收到信息時(shí)確認(rèn)或當(dāng)主站發(fā)出請(qǐng)求時(shí)向它發(fā)信息,所以只需總線協(xié)議一小部分,既經(jīng)
濟(jì),實(shí)時(shí)性也強(qiáng)。
  3、產(chǎn)品要具有互操作性
  各制造商產(chǎn)品要通過(guò)所屬各類(lèi)總線制協(xié)議符合其規(guī)定的OSI標(biāo)準(zhǔn)一次性測(cè)試,及互操作性測(cè)試
,并以專(zhuān)門(mén)測(cè)試中心認(rèn)證。為了提高其可靠性,還要經(jīng)過(guò)在惡劣環(huán)境下魯棒測(cè)試。接口技術(shù)采用了
OEM集成方法構(gòu)成產(chǎn)品,可以實(shí)現(xiàn)數(shù)據(jù)開(kāi)放式傳輸。
  因此,對(duì)于同一類(lèi)型協(xié)議的不同制造商產(chǎn)品可以混合組態(tài)與調(diào)用為一個(gè)開(kāi)放系統(tǒng),使它具有互
操作性。
  4、要求具有較高可靠性措施:
 ?。?)硬件經(jīng)過(guò)嚴(yán)格挑選,采用專(zhuān)用芯片(ASIC)和表面安裝技術(shù)(SMT)。
 ?。?)系統(tǒng)軟件選用成熟適合實(shí)際需要的簡(jiǎn)單易用軟件,及好的工具軟件。應(yīng)用軟件采用功能模
塊化設(shè)計(jì),定義清晰明確。
 ?。?)可通過(guò)在線可快速排除故障,強(qiáng)化硬件可修復(fù)性,如I/O模板可帶電插拔,且診斷故障顯
示,故障時(shí)部件自動(dòng)隔離等
 ?。?)軟件上分離化體系結(jié)構(gòu)及各過(guò)程站有地域上各自獨(dú)立的局部數(shù)據(jù)庫(kù)。并經(jīng)過(guò)通信網(wǎng)絡(luò)在邏
輯上形成全局?jǐn)?shù)據(jù)庫(kù)。
 ?。?)有多級(jí)安全措施,采用容錯(cuò)技術(shù)與冗余技術(shù)。
  現(xiàn)場(chǎng)總線的主要產(chǎn)品
  連接于總線上的產(chǎn)品,可以分為有源和無(wú)源兩大類(lèi)。
  有源產(chǎn)品可以產(chǎn)生通訊信號(hào)、響應(yīng)信號(hào)、調(diào)整信號(hào)或者兼而有之。 有源產(chǎn)品包括以下部件:
 
  1. 節(jié)點(diǎn)(Node)-總線上可以編址的設(shè)備。
  2. 總線模塊(Bus Module)-任何形式的現(xiàn)場(chǎng)節(jié)點(diǎn),可以使用端子或接插件連接傳感器、閥門(mén)、
按鈕等各種現(xiàn)場(chǎng)裝置。
  3. 網(wǎng)關(guān)(Gateway):一種特殊的節(jié)點(diǎn),用于兩種不同的總線之間的信號(hào)和數(shù)據(jù)變換。
  4. 放大器 - 一種用于實(shí)時(shí)(加強(qiáng))信號(hào),以精確復(fù)制原始信號(hào)。連接同一總線的兩部分,解
決通訊信號(hào)在通訊線上由于電氣損耗而造成的衰減。當(dāng)信號(hào)變?nèi)醵蛔冃螘r(shí)可以使用放大器。
  5. 中繼器(Repeater)-用于加強(qiáng)信號(hào),產(chǎn)生不變形的新信號(hào)。連接同一總線的兩,當(dāng)信號(hào)變
弱或變形時(shí)可以使用中繼器。
  6. 橋(Bridge)- 有兩類(lèi)橋。一種是用于連接同一種協(xié)議,不同傳輸速度的兩個(gè)段。另一種是
一種智能的中繼器,當(dāng)通訊的源地址和目的地址位于不同總線段時(shí),用于重復(fù)兩個(gè)段間的數(shù)據(jù)。橋
必須被編程設(shè)定地址和相關(guān)的段。當(dāng)橋讀地址時(shí),要有幾個(gè)位的等待時(shí)間。橋可以應(yīng)用于設(shè)備級(jí)總
線,但應(yīng)用并不普遍。
  7. 路由器(Router)- 用于廣域網(wǎng)的高等級(jí)橋。這類(lèi)產(chǎn)品很少應(yīng)用于設(shè)備級(jí)總線。
  8. 有源多端口分接器(Active hub)- 多端口中繼器或放大器,以增加總線的分支能力。
  9. 接口卡、接口模塊(Interface card, interface module)-指網(wǎng)關(guān)的常用術(shù)語(yǔ),作為PLC或
PC到設(shè)備及總線的接口。
  無(wú)源總線產(chǎn)品包括:
  a. T型分支(Tee)-用于產(chǎn)生總線上的一路分支   
  b. 無(wú)源多端口分接器(Passive hub)-多端口T型分支。
  c. 終端電阻(Terminating Resistor)-安裝在總線的始端和末端的電阻,用于穩(wěn)定和調(diào)整信
號(hào)。
  d. 總線電纜(Busline)-連接節(jié)點(diǎn),傳送數(shù)據(jù)的各種電纜。


評(píng)論


技術(shù)專(zhuān)區(qū)

關(guān)閉